diff options
author | Tobias Klauser <tklauser@distanz.ch> | 2014-08-14 18:27:25 +0200 |
---|---|---|
committer | Tobias Klauser <tklauser@distanz.ch> | 2014-08-14 18:38:27 +0200 |
commit | d1eef162252faf60b2acb19a1df70c1a5e13ecd2 (patch) | |
tree | 7fa4ffd076fa2b0fa7d9811523ef3b48fd40ecad | |
parent | 0fab564a98d1a54bc6b6eeac57f41ce182c38018 (diff) |
netsniff-ng: Use correct parameters to show_frame_hdr()
Commit edca6174b09 ("dissector: Restore paket type if capturing from
nlmon device") changed the signature of show_frame_hdr(). The call to
this function was not updated in the !HAVE_TPACKET3 part of netsniff-ng
introduced in commit 97e6f994785c ("netsniff-ng: Restore tpacket v2
capturing"), causing a compile error. Fix this by providing the correct
parameters to show_frame_hdr() also in this case.
Signed-off-by: Tobias Klauser <tklauser@distanz.ch>
-rw-r--r-- | netsniff-ng.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/netsniff-ng.c b/netsniff-ng.c index 984f9ca..05d1267 100644 --- a/netsniff-ng.c +++ b/netsniff-ng.c @@ -981,7 +981,8 @@ static void recv_only_or_dump(struct ctx *ctx) panic("Write error to pcap!\n"); } - show_frame_hdr(hdr, ctx->print_mode); + show_frame_hdr(packet, hdr->tp_h.tp_snaplen, + ctx->link_type, hdr, ctx->print_mode); dissector_entry_point(packet, hdr->tp_h.tp_snaplen, ctx->link_type, ctx->print_mode); |